Durrani, Haris A. 2016. “Space Law, Shari’a, and the Legal Place of a Scientific Enterprise: The Case for a Parallel Challenge of Sovereignty”. Comparative Islamic Studies 10 (1): 27-59. https://doi.org/10.1558/cis.26732.